USD.AI Approves Monumental $500M Loan for Australian AI Firm Sharon AI in Groundbreaking Deal

In a landmark development for both the cryptocurrency and artificial intelligence sectors, on-chain lending protocol USD.AI has approved a monumental $500 million loan facility for Australian AI infrastructure provider Sharon AI. This groundbreaking transaction, first reported by The Block on November 15, 2024, represents one of the largest blockchain-based financings in AI history and signals a major shift in how technology companies access capital for hardware-intensive operations.

USD.AI Loan Revolutionizes AI Infrastructure Financing

The $500 million USD.AI loan facility will directly support Sharon AI’s ambitious GPU deployment expansion across Australia and the Asia-Pacific region. According to official documentation reviewed by industry analysts, the company plans to utilize the facility immediately, beginning with an initial $65 million GPU acquisition scheduled for completion this quarter. This strategic move comes as global demand for AI computing power continues to surge exponentially, with NVIDIA reporting a 265% year-over-year increase in data center revenue during their most recent quarterly earnings.

USD.AI operates as a specialized blockchain-based lending platform specifically designed for AI startups that face significant barriers within traditional financial systems. The protocol’s innovative approach involves providing loans collateralized by tokenized GPU assets, creating a transparent and efficient financing mechanism. This model addresses several critical pain points in AI infrastructure development:

  • Accessibility: Traditional banks often hesitate to finance rapidly depreciating hardware assets
  • Liquidity: Tokenization enables fractional ownership and secondary market trading
  • Transparency: Blockchain provides immutable records of asset ownership and loan terms
  • Speed: Smart contracts automate approval processes that typically take months

Blockchain Meets Artificial Intelligence Infrastructure

The intersection of blockchain technology and AI hardware financing represents a significant evolution in both sectors. Historically, AI companies requiring substantial GPU resources faced considerable challenges securing traditional financing due to several factors. Banks typically view computing hardware as rapidly depreciating assets with uncertain residual value, while venture capital often prefers equity investments in software rather than debt financing for hardware.

USD.AI’s solution bridges this financing gap through its tokenized collateral system. The protocol converts physical GPU assets into digital tokens on the blockchain, enabling transparent valuation and creating liquid collateral that traditional lenders cannot easily replicate. This approach has gained traction particularly among AI infrastructure providers in regions with less developed venture capital ecosystems, including Australia, Southeast Asia, and parts of Europe.

Technical Implementation and Risk Management

The USD.AI protocol employs sophisticated risk management mechanisms to ensure loan security while providing accessible capital. Each tokenized GPU undergoes rigorous valuation processes incorporating multiple data points:

  • Current market price from major distributors
  • Historical depreciation rates for specific models
  • Regional demand indicators and utilization rates
  • Manufacturer warranty status and remaining coverage
  • Energy efficiency metrics and operational costs

This comprehensive valuation approach enables USD.AI to maintain conservative loan-to-value ratios, typically between 50-70% of the tokenized asset’s assessed worth. The protocol also implements automated monitoring systems that track GPU performance metrics in real-time, providing early warning indicators for potential maintenance issues or technological obsolescence.

Sharon AI’s specific implementation involves deploying the newly acquired GPUs across multiple data center locations in Sydney, Melbourne, and Singapore. This geographic diversification strategy mitigates operational risks while optimizing latency for clients across the Asia-Pacific region. The company has already secured pre-commitments for approximately 40% of the new capacity from enterprise clients in financial services, healthcare, and scientific research sectors.

FAQs

Q1: What is USD.AI and how does it differ from traditional lenders?
USD.AI is a blockchain-based lending protocol specifically designed for AI companies. Unlike traditional banks, it accepts tokenized GPU assets as collateral and operates through smart contracts, enabling faster approval processes and greater transparency than conventional financing options.

Q2: Why would an AI company choose blockchain financing over traditional options?
AI infrastructure companies often struggle with traditional financing because banks view computing hardware as rapidly depreciating assets. Blockchain protocols like USD.AI understand the specific valuation dynamics of AI hardware and can structure loans that traditional institutions might decline due to perceived risk profiles.

Q3: How does tokenizing GPU assets work as collateral?
Tokenization converts physical GPU assets into digital tokens on a blockchain. Each token represents ownership rights to specific hardware, enabling transparent valuation, fractional ownership, and secondary market trading. This creates liquid collateral that maintains value better within lending arrangements.

Q4: What are the main risks associated with this type of financing?
Primary risks include technological obsolescence of GPU assets, cryptocurrency market volatility affecting collateral values, regulatory uncertainty in some jurisdictions, and potential smart contract vulnerabilities. However, protocols like USD.AI implement multiple risk mitigation strategies including conservative loan-to-value ratios and real-time asset monitoring.

CME Group to launch options on XRP and SOL futures

CME Group to launch options on XRP and SOL futures

The post CME Group to launch options on XRP and SOL futures appeared on BitcoinEthereumNews.com. CME Group will offer options based on the derivative markets on Solana (SOL) and XRP. The new markets will open on October 13, after regulatory approval.  CME Group will expand its crypto products with options on the futures markets of Solana (SOL) and XRP. The futures market will start on October 13, after regulatory review and approval.  The options will allow the trading of MicroSol, XRP, and MicroXRP futures, with expiry dates available every business day, monthly, and quarterly. The new products will be added to the existing BTC and ETH options markets. ‘The launch of these options contracts builds on the significant growth and increasing liquidity we have seen across our suite of Solana and XRP futures,’ said Giovanni Vicioso, CME Group Global Head of Cryptocurrency Products. The options contracts will have two main sizes, tracking the futures contracts. The new market will be suitable for sophisticated institutional traders, as well as active individual traders. The addition of options markets singles out XRP and SOL as liquid enough to offer the potential to bet on a market direction.  The options on futures arrive a few months after the launch of SOL futures. Both SOL and XRP had peak volumes in August, though XRP activity has slowed down in September. XRP and SOL options to tap both institutions and active traders Crypto options are one of the indicators of market attitudes, with XRP and SOL receiving a new way to gauge sentiment.
